中文摘要: 为提升继电保护产品性能, 设计了一种新型的微机继电保护平台. 采用PowerPc 架构的处理器MPC8309 作为保护和管理通信的主控芯片, 保护板和管理通信板分别设计, 具有独立的采样板, 板间采用高速以太网及LVDS信号进行数据交换. 软件系统分层次分模块设计, 采用Nucleus嵌入式实时操作系统. 本文结合具体的应用案例, 详细描述了该平台的软硬件设计方案, 以及设计过程中的关键点, 并对底层配置作了详细介绍. 该平台功能完善、稳定性好, 能够较好的满足保护装置的性能要求. 该平台适用于各种电压等级的电力设备继电保护测控装置的应用,目前已成功应用于高压微机线路保护装置中.

Abstract:To improve the performance of relay protection devices, a new microcomputer relay protection platform is designed. In this platform, MPC8309 based on PowerPc architecture is the core controller of the protection unit and the communication unit which are designed respectively, and a sampling board is designed independently. Boards are interconnected with high speed ethernet interface and LVDS. The software system based on Nucleus embedded real- time operating system is designed hierarchically and modularized. Combined with a specific application case, the hardware and software design of the platform are described in detail, with the key points in the process of design and the underlying configuration. The platform with perfect function and good stability can satisfy the performance requirements for protective devices. The relay protection platform is suitable for relay protection measurement and control device of power equipment of all kinds of voltage grade, and has been successfully applied to high voltage line protection devices.
